Fortunately, there are effective alternatives to litigation. Mediation and other Alternative Dispute Resolution mechanisms (ADR) offer a mutually beneficial approach to resolving conflict.

Mediation utilizes a neutral third party, the mediator, who supports a dialogue between individuals involved. divorce dispute resolution The mediator does not taking a stance but instead helps parties to communicate effectively.

ADR covers a spectrum of methods, such as negotiation, arbitration, and facilitation. These methods offer flexibility in addressing varied types of conflict.

By providing a structured framework for communication and problem-solving, ADR mechanisms can assist parties to:

* Maintain relationships

* Reduce costs and time associated with litigation

* Achieve mutually acceptable outcomes

* Gain a sense of control and empowerment

Choosing the right ADR technique is contingent upon the nature of the conflict. Consulting with an experienced ADR practitioner can help parties identify the most suitable path to resolution.
